A breathalyzer test is used by police in an area to determine whether a driver's blood alcohol content (BAC) is above the legal limit. The device is not totally reliable: 5.8% of drivers who have not consumed too much alcohol give a BAC reading from the breathalyzer as being above the legal limit, while 10.7% of drivers who have consumed too much alcohol will give a BAC reading below that level. Suppose that in fact, 6.9% of drivers are above the legal alcohol limit, and the police stop a driver at random.
